alohe/avatars 开源项目安装与使用教程
欢迎来到 alohe/avatars 开源项目教程,本项目旨在提供一个灵活且可定制的头像生成解决方案。下面是关于该项目的基本结构、关键文件以及如何快速上手的指南。
1. 项目目录结构及介绍
该开源项目采用了一种清晰的分层结构以便于维护和扩展:
-
src: 包含核心源代码,是项目的主体部分。
avatarGenerator.js
: 头像生成的主要逻辑实现。styles
: 存放样式文件,用于定义头像的外观。
-
config: 配置相关文件存放于此。
generatorConfig.json
: 定义头像生成的默认参数和风格选项。
-
public: 静态资源文件夹,可能包括示例图片或其他前端展示所需的资源。
-
docs: 文档资料,虽然实际项目中这通常包含API文档等,但在这个假设的场景下,它可用来存放自定义的说明文档。
-
examples: 提供简单的示例或入门级应用案例,帮助新用户快速理解如何使用这个库。
-
package.json: Node.js项目的元数据文件,包含项目的依赖、脚本命令等。
-
README.md: 项目简介、安装步骤和快速使用指南。
2. 项目的启动文件介绍
在 alohe/avatars 中,没有明确指定“启动文件”,但在Node.js环境中,常见的启动入口通常是通过index.js
或者根据package.json
中的main
字段指定的文件。假设开发环境下,一个示例的启动文件可能是src/index.js
或者在scripts
部分有一个名为start
的命令,例如:
"scripts": {
"start": "node src/index.js"
}
执行npm start
或yarn start
命令时,Node.js将运行指定的文件,通常用于启动服务或进行某些即时操作。
3. 项目的配置文件介绍
-
generatorConfig.json 此文件是项目的配置中心,包含了生成头像的具体设置项。它可能包括颜色方案、形状、尺寸等个性化选项。
{ "defaultColor": "#333", "shapes": ["circle", "square"], "sizes": [48, 64, 128], ... }
用户可以根据需求调整这些配置,以适应不同的应用场景。
结论
通过以上模块的学习,您应该能够熟悉alohe/avatars项目的基础架构,并能够开始自定义头像的生成过程。记得在具体操作前查看最新的README.md
文件,因为项目详情可能会随着时间而更新。希望这份教程对您的开发工作有所帮助!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考